Product Description
Ferio Tego Metropolitan Host Maduro Hobart cigars are created by Michael Herklots and Brendon Scott, who formerly worked for Nat Sherman. They purchased the rights to the blend names that were once used by Nat Sherman, though they are not allowed to use the Nat Sherman brand name. Honduras is the home of the 5 x 50 ring format cigars, which are made with a dark and oily Connecticut Broadleaf maduro wrapper, a binder of only the finest aged tobacco, and a filler of long-aged Honduran tobacco.
